非定态FEL在线性区性态的数值模拟

SIMULATIONS OF SIMULATIONS OF THE NON-STEADY STATE FEL IN THE LINEAR REGIME

  • 摘要: 利用于敏教授建立的一堆非定态FEL方程进行数值模拟,研究了FEL在线性区的脉冲传播、增益发展和滑移区超辐射等性态。数值结果表明,滑移对增益的影响跟电子束纵向分布和滑移长度与脉冲长度之比有关;对同样的滑移参数,滑移对增益相对于定态区增益的强弱由束电流决定。

     

    Abstract: In this paper we used the one-dimensionala non-steady state FEL equations developed by Prof,Yu Min to make some numericall simulations,We investigated the FEL pulse propagation,gain development and superradiance in the slippage section in the linear regime,It is shown by the numerical results that the effects of slippage on the gain is related to the longitudinal distributions of the electron beam and the ratio of the slippage length and the electron pulse length,and the gain in the slippage section, relative to that in the steady state section,is determined by the beam current for the same slippage parameter.
